simoni_sc.jpgGuido was a graduate of the the University of Santa Clara. A big hard throwing right handed pitcher, as well as a bruising fullback and punter on the gridiron. Like many athletes of that era, baseball was the only avenue to pursue professionally. Guidos's true stardom was as a Punter, for which he is so honored in his almamater's(University of Santa Clara) athlete Hall of fame.

 

simoni_babe.jpg
In 1927 Guido had a photo opportunity of a lifetime. Babe Ruth visited Santa Clara and posed with the young collegian athlete.

 

Guido never made it to the Major League. After a couple of seasons in the PCL he took a job with MJB Coffee and pitched for the company semipro team. His professional experienced helped his team win the California State League title in 1934.
